Transaction bbeabde32be14fa490735817d304381ff07aea85abe4ba40438beb712e1955ba
1 Input
1 Output
-
bbeabde32be14fa490735817d304381ff07aea85abe4ba40438beb712e1955ba:0
- value
- 742000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 84c899d95c1a0e4b9ec46dd86dc6c9ba9049e06d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D76WKeja5oFhH6NR9Uyqw8HYayQaA6sB3